During the 2020-2021 academic year, University of South Alabama handed out 31 bachelor's degrees in parks, recreation & leisure studies. This is a decrease of 37% over the previous year when 49 degrees were handed out.

How Much Do Parks & Rec Graduates from USA Make?

$26,609 Bachelor's Median Salary

Salary of Parks & Rec Graduates with a Bachelor's Degree

Parks & Rec majors who earn their bachelor's degree from USA go on to jobs where they make a median salary of $26,609 a year. Unfortunately, this is lower than the national average of $31,674 for all parks & rec students.

How Much Student Debt Do Parks & Rec Graduates from USA Have?

$26,750 Bachelor's Median Debt

Student Debt of Parks & Rec Graduates with a Bachelor's Degree

While getting their bachelor's degree at USA, parks & rec students borrow a median amount of $26,750 in student loans. This is higher than the the typical median of $24,363 for all parks & rec majors across the country.

undefined

The typical student loan payment of a bachelor's degree student from the parks & rec program at USA is $343 per month.

USA Parks, Recreation & Leisure Studies Bachelor’s Program

Of the 31 parks & rec students who graduated with a bachelor's degree in 2020-2021 from USA, about 35% were men and 65% were women.

undefined

The majority of bachelor's degree recipients in this major at USA are white. In the most recent graduating class for which data is available, 61% of students fell into this category.
